    Clinical Assistant Professor in Entrepreneurship

    State University of New York at Buffalo

     

    Description            The UB School of Management seeks someone with a passion for building an entrepreneurship capability within a university setting, and the ability to bring that same enthusiasm into the classroom.  A primary responsibility will involve teaching in the University's undergraduate Entrepreneurship Academy and offering entrepreneurship courses in the School's undergraduate and graduate programs.  Much of this student interaction will occur outside the traditional classroom setting and involve mentoring efforts to move initiatives from the idea stage to possible commercialization. In addition, this individual will take the lead in developing opportunities for the School of Management to directly support the entrepreneurship community, as well as working with students to fully realize their entrepreneurial potential.  This involves networking, relationship building and the ability to assess how University resources could contribute to the success of these enterprises, and how the entrepreneurship community can support our University programs.  It will also include participation in course offerings through the Center for Entrepreneurial Leadership.

    Qualifications       Candidates should have demonstrated record of success at building relationships between the academic and entrepreneurship communities, evidence of outstanding teaching in both graduate and undergraduate programs, and experience as a successful entrepreneur.  An MBA is strongly preferred.

    Department          The Department of Operations Management & Strategy offers undergraduate, MBA and Ph.D. programs in Strategy/Entrepreneurship, and Supply Chain & Operations Management  

    School                     The UB School of Management is recognized for its emphasis on real-world learning, community and economic impact, and the global perspective of its faculty, students and alumni. The school has been ranked by Bloomberg Business Week, the Financial Times, Forbes and U.S. News and World Report. For more information, please visit http://mgt.buffalo.edu/.

    University              The University at Buffalo is a premier research-intensive public university, a flagship institution in the State University of New York system and the largest and most comprehensive campus in the system. Founded in 1846, the University at Buffalo is a member of the Association of American Universities.

    Location                  The School is located in Amherst, a campus town in the north east of Buffalo. Known as the "City of Good Neighbors," Buffalo is New York's second largest city, offering the area's 1.3 million residents the attractions and convenience of a major urban center along with the friendliness and livability of a medium-sized town.
